What screen resolution are you using? I notice that the focus group (FG) opens to the far right of the layout, and if tmg is windowed, the FG is half off the screen. If you are using 800x600, it may be out of sight.

 

Are you using the Standard layout with large buttons on the toolbar?

 

As Lorna suggested, if you click on Focus Group on the Window menu and you don't see it open in your layout, go to the Window menu and click on Center the Current Window. Occasionally a window will open behind your layout where you can't see it, and Center the Current Window will bring it to the forefront.

 

We still have to figure out why the focus person is not being added to the Focus Group. Try this: in the FG, click on the Add Individual.. button and enter the ID# of the focus person and see if that works.

I did a search on this problem and found this thread. I'm having the same problem as of today.

 

I added a new father to an individual and the "Image" window I had on screen closed. When I select "Window" - "Image", the 'Focus Group' window opens instead. (If I select "Window" - "Focus Group", nothing opens.)

 

I was using a custom layout and it still showed I was using that layout. I made no changes to my layout though since all I did was simply add an individual and the window disappeared. All my other windows in my custom layout are in place where they should be.

 

I was running TMG v6.05 and tried to reindex/optimize, but that did not help. I then updated to v6.08 and still have the same problem.

 

The menu command "Window" - "Image" still opens the Focus Group window. The same thing happens if I click the "Image window" button on the toolbar. I can find no way to open my Image window now and when I try to open it, the wrong window opens.

 

Another thing that is weird is when I select "Tools" - "Exhibit Log", none of the images show up. It shows 9 thumbnails placeholders for the 9 images for the person I pulled up, but they are blank (gray) with no actual image. It also shows the description for each one if I click on them, but no image.

 

If I try to double click on one of the gray images, I get an error message of below:

 

"OLE error code 0x. 218 FRMEXHIBIT.MVIEWEXHIBIT"

 

It has 'Abort', 'Retry', 'Ignore' buttons. Clicking all of the buttons do not help.

 

I have not moved my exhibit location.

 

Was there ever a resolution to the original poster of this issue or is there something else to try or something going on with my images?

I did update my TMG to v6.08 and it didn't help. However, I completely uninstalled and reinstalled TMG and now it functions properly without any errors. I probably should have done this before I searched the forums here, but since I had changed nothing with TMG, it seemed a rather odd problem to just pop up out of nowhere.

 

So in the end, other than a bit of confusion and an un-answered question as to what happened, I'm back up and running.
